file-type

ExMod串口调试助手:Excel文件数据及Modbus Rtu Master功能详解

1星 | 下载需积分: 49 | 575KB | 更新于2025-02-02 | 138 浏览量 | 46 下载量 举报 9 收藏
download 立即下载
### 知识点详细说明 #### 标题解析 1. **ExMod 串口调试助手**: 一款用于上位机串口编程调试的辅助软件,它的主要功能包括发送串口数据和模拟数据接收。 2. **发送Excel等文件中数据**: 该软件能够读取Excel、CSV或文本文件,并将文件中的数据发送到串口。 3. **Modbus Rtu Master功能**: ExMod具备Modbus Rtu协议的主站功能,可以实现Modbus Rtu协议相关的数据读取和发送。 #### 描述解析 1. **ExMod串口调试助手的功能**: - **基本串口数据发送**: 包括发送任意格式的串口数据,并提供计算CRC校验码功能。 - **Modbus数据读取和发送**: 支持单条Modbus数据的读取和发送,包括读取Holding寄存器、读取输入寄存器、写入多个寄存器。 - **大量数据发送**: 通过“发送文件中数据”功能区,可以实现大量数据的发送,包括自定义协议和Modbus Rtu协议的数据。 - **数据格式支持**: 支持Excel、CSV、文本文件三种格式,文本文件在软件中按CSV格式处理。 - **延时设置**: 允许用户设置多条数据间发送的间隔时间。 - **寄存器地址管理**: 可以设定文件中数据的寄存器地址,支持同一地址或不同地址的数据发送。 - **发送选项**: 包括发送范围、发送间隔、数据格式的设置,以及是否按照Modbus格式发送的选择。 - **接收数据处理**: 超过0.1M的数据会自动保存到文本文件中,用户也可以手动保存数据。 2. **软件使用说明**: - **主界面功能区**: 软件主界面划分为三个功能区域,分别对应不同的功能模块。 - **数据发送和校验**: “发送任意串口数据”用于基本的串口数据发送,并支持CRC校验。 - **Modbus数据读写**: 功能区2提供了Modbus协议下对寄存器进行读取和写入操作的具体命令。 - **文件数据发送**: 功能区3涉及发送文件中的数据,并允许用户设置发送选项。 #### 标签解析 1. **串口**: 标识该软件主要用于串口数据的发送和接收。 2. **发送大量数据**: 说明软件能够处理并发送大量数据,适应不同场合的需要。 3. **Excel**: 强调软件支持从Excel文件读取数据。 4. **Modbus**: 标识软件支持Modbus协议,主要用于工业自动化领域。 #### 压缩包子文件的文件名称列表解析 1. **ExMod.sln**: Visual Studio解决方案文件,包含了软件的项目文件和编译配置。 2. **ExMod.suo**: Visual Studio解决方案用户选项文件,记录了用户对解决方案的自定义设置。 3. **ExMod**: 指代软件的主执行程序文件或软件的项目目录。 4. **Lib**: 库文件目录,可能存放了软件运行所需的库文件或模块。 5. **ico**: 图标文件,通常用于软件界面的图标显示。 #### 综合知识点 ExMod串口调试助手是一款集成了串口数据发送、Modbus Rtu协议数据处理、文件数据读取等多功能于一身的调试工具。它面向的主要应用场景包括工业自动化、设备测试以及任何需要通过串口进行数据通信的场合。该软件提供了直观的用户界面,用户可以轻松地进行数据的发送、接收以及校验操作。 在使用过程中,用户可以通过读取Excel、CSV或文本文件的方式快速加载需要发送的数据,大大提高了调试工作的效率。软件还允许用户自定义发送的数据格式,如设置数据发送的范围、发送间隔以及是否按照Modbus协议格式发送,这为使用自定义协议的用户提供了便利。另外,软件还支持Modbus Rtu协议下的常见操作,如读取Holding寄存器、读取输入寄存器以及写入多个寄存器等,这意味着它可以在工业控制系统中扮演重要角色。 软件的高级功能,如CRC校验计算、数据自动保存等,不仅提高了数据处理的准确性,也为长期的调试工作提供了便利。CRC校验作为确保数据完整性和准确性的常用方法,在串口通信中尤为重要。此外,软件能够自动保存超过一定大小的数据,避免了重要数据的丢失,便于开发者进行后续分析和调试。 在开发和测试过程中,ExMod串口调试助手的易用性、稳定性以及丰富的功能使得它成为一个值得推荐的工具。它不仅能够满足专业人士的需求,也降低了初学者在学习串口通信时的门槛。

相关推荐